    Bristol City NEWS: Could Steve Cotterill be set for Nottingham Forest return after Freedman sacking?

    STEVE Cotterill has been placed at 25/1 by the bookies to replace sacked Nottingham Forest boss Dougie Freedman.
    The Cheltenham-born boss left as Bristol City manager in January after leading them to the League One title and the Johnstone's Paint Trophy last season.
    Cotterill previously managed Championship side Forest but after less than a year in charge departed the club in July 2012

    He then went on to coach at QPR before moving to Ashton Gate.
    Former Leicester City chief Nigel Pearson is the short-priced favourite with Sky Bet at 4/1, while the likes of Billy Davies 6/1, David Moyes 10/1 and Gary Monk 12/1 all appear high up the list.
